Publications

The activities of the project have currently resulted in the following publications:

1. "The DeSyRe project: on-Demand System Reliability", Ioannis Sourdis, Christos Strydis, Christos-Savvas Bouganis, Babak Falsafi, Georgi N. Gaydadjiev, Alirad Malek, Riccardo Mariani, Dionisios N. Pnevmatikatos, Dhiraj K. Pradhan, Gerard Rauwerda, Kim Sunesen and Stavros Tzilis, 15th EUROMICRO Conference on Digital System Design (DSD), Cesme, Izmir, Turkey, September 2012.

2. “Preliminary Concepts for Designing a Graceful Degradation Manager for a Fault Tolerant by Design SoC” S. Tzilis, I. Sourdis, ACACES 2012 (abstract), Fiuggi, Itally, July, 2012.

3. “Architecture-Level Fault Tolerance for Biomedical Implants,” R.M. Seepers, C.Strydis, G.N. Gaydadjiev, Int'l Conf. on Embedded Computer Systems: Architectures, Modeling and Simulation (SAMOS), IEEE, pp. 104-112, 16-19 July 2012.

4. “A Closed-loop Control Strategy for Glucose Control in Artificial Pancreas Systems” Galadanci, J. Shafik, R.A. Mathew, J. and Acharyya, A. (Accepted). In: IEEE Computer Society Intl. Symposium on Electronic Systems Design, Kolkata, India, 2012.

5. “Design techniques of future reliable SoCs” Sourdis, Ioannis, Strydis, Christos, 2013 2nd Mediterranean Conference on Embedded Computing (MECO), 2013 , 1- 2.

6. "DeSyRe: on-Demand System Reliability", I. Sourdis, Chalmers, C. Strydis, A. Armato, C.-S. Bouganis, B. Falsafi, G. Gaydadjiev, S. Isaza, A. Malek, R. Mariani, Yogitech, D.N. Pnevmatikatos, D.K Pradhan, G. Rauwerda, R. Seepers, R.K. Shafik, K. Sunesen, D. Theodoropoulos, S. Tzilis, M. Vavouras, in Elsevier Microprocessors and Microsystems, Special Issue on European Projects, 2013.

7. “Efficient Runtime Support for Embedded MPSoCs”, Dimitris Theodoropoulos, Polyvios Pratikakis, Dionisios Pnevmatikatos, In IEEE International Conference on Embedded Computer Systems: Architectures, Modeling, and Simulation (SAMOS XIII) conference. 164–171.

8. “Fault recovery for an FPGA mapped artificial pancreas using partial reconfiguration” M. Vavouras, C-S. Bouganis, ACACES 2013, Fiuggi, Itally.

9. "Heuristic Search for Adaptive, Defect-Tolerant Multiprocessor Arrays", Vasileios Vasilikos, Georgios Smaragdos, Christos Strydis, Ioannis Sourdis. in ACM Transactions on Embedded Computing Systems, 12(1) Article 44, March 2013.

10. “Introduction to Energy Efficient Fault Tolerant Systems”. Shafik, R.A., Mathew, J. and Pradhan, D.K. (in press) Chapter in Book: Energy Efficient Fault Tolerant Systems, Eds. Mathew, J., Shafik, R.A. and Pradhan, D.K., Springer USA.

11. “on-Demand System Reliability: The DeSyRe project” I. Sourdis, Chalmers, SAMOS XIII, July 2013, Samos, Greece.

12. "Software Modification Aided Transient Error Tolerance for Embedded Systems", Rishad A Shafik, Gerard K Rauwerda, Jordy Potman, Dhiraj Pradhan, Jimson Mathew and Ioannis Sourdis, 16th EUROMICRO Conference on Digital System Design (DSD), September 2013.

13. “System-level Design Methodology”, Shafik, R.A. et al. (in press). Chapter in Book: Energy Efficient Fault Tolerant Systems, Eds. Mathew, J., Shafik, R.A. and Pradhan, D.K., Springer USA.

14. “Tolerating permanent faults using reconfigurable hardware” A. Malek, I. Sourdis, Chalmers, ACACES 2013, Fiuggi, Itally.

15. “Towards on-demand system reliability: software implemented fault tolerance and testing”, Sourdis, I., Shafik, R.A., Strydis, C., Pnevmatikatos, D., Theodoropoulos, D., Pradhan, D.K. and Rauwerda, G. (2013) Towards on-demand system reliability: software implemented fault tolerance and testing. European Test Symposium (ETS), Avignon, FR, 27 - 31 May 2013. , in-press.

16. “Towards Reliable Task Parallel Programs”, Dimitrios Skarlatos, Polyvios Pratikakis, Dionysios Pnevmatikatos, HiPEAC 5th Workshop on Design for Reliability (DFR 2013).

17. Building Fast, Dense, Low-Power Caches Using Erasure-Based Inline Multi-Bit ECC, Jangwoo Kim, Hyunggyun Yang, Mark P. McCartney, Mudit Bhargava, Ken Mai and Babak Falsafi, The 19th IEEE Pacific Rim International Symposium on Dependable Computing, December 2013 (PRDC 2013).

18. Ioannis Sourdis, Danish Anis Khan, Alirad Malek, Stavros Tzilis, Georgios Smaragdos, Christos Strydis, "Resilient CMPs with Mixed-grain Reconfigurability", accepted in IEEE Micro, special series on "Harsh Chips", 2014.

19. C. Strydis, R.M. Seepers, P. Peris-Lopez, D. Siskos, I. Sourdis, "A System Architecture, Processor and Communication Protocol for Secure Implants", in ACM Transactions on Architecture and Code Optimization (TACO), 10, 4, Article 57, December 2013.

20. I. Sourdis, C. Strydis, A. Armato, C.-S. Bouganis, B. Falsafi, G. Gaydadjiev, S. Isaza, A. Malek, R. Mariani, D.N. Pnevmatikatos, D.K Pradhan, G. Rauwerda, R. Seepers, R.K. Shafik, K. Sunesen, D. Theodoropoulos, S. Tzilis, M. Vavouras,, DeSyRe: on-Demand System Reliability, in Elsevier Microprocessors and Microsystems, Special Issue on European Projects in Embedded System Design: EPESD2012, Volume 37, Issue 8, Part C, Pages 981-1001, November 2013,

21. Alirad Malek, Stavros Tzilis, Danish Anis Khan, Ioannis Sourdis, Georgios Smaragdos and Christos Strydis, "A Probabilistic Analysis of Resilient Reconfigurable Designs", in International Symposium on Defect and Fault Tolerance in VLSI and Nanotechnology Systems (DFT), Amsterdam, 2014.

22. Stavros Tzilis, Ioannis Sourdis, "A Runtime Manager for Gracefully Degrading SoCs",in International Symposium on Defect and Fault Tolerance in VLSI and Nanotechnology Systems (DFT), Amsterdam, 2014.

23. Dimitris Theodoropoulos, Dionisios Pnevmatikatos, Stavros Tzilis, Ioannis Sourdis, "The DeSyRe Runtime support for Fault-tolerant Embedded MPSoCs", in the 12th IEEE International Symposium on Parallel and Distributed Processing with Applications (ISPA), 2014.

24. Robert M. Seepers, Christos Strydis, Pedro Peris-Lopez, Ioannis Sourdis, Chris I. De Zeeuw, "Peak Misdetection In Heart-Beat-Based Security: Characterization and Tolerance", in 36th Annual International IEEE EMBS Conference, 2014.

25. Georgios Smaragdos, Craig Davies, Christos Strydis, Ioannis Sourdis, Catalin Ciobanu and Oskar Mencer, "Real-Time Olivo-Cerebellar Neuron Simulations on Dataflow Computing Machines", in Int'l Supercomputing Conference (ISC), Leipzig, Germany, June, 2014.

26. Georgios Smaragdos, Danish Anis Khan, Ioannis Sourdis, Christos Strydis, Alirad Malek and Stavros Tzilis, "A Dependable Coarse-grain Reconfigurable Multicore Array", in 21st Reconfigurable Architectures Workshop (RAW'14) IEEE, held together with IPDPS, Phoenix, USA , May 19-20, 2014.

27. Georgios Smaragdos, Sebastian Isaza, Martijn Van Eijk, Ioannis Sourdis and Christos Strydis, "FPGA-based Biophysically-Meaningful Modeling of Olivocerebellar Neurons", 22nd ACM/SIGDA International Symposium on Field-Programmable Gate Arrays (FPGA), Monterey, California, February, 2014.

28. I. Sourdis, C. Strydis, A. Armato, C.S. Bouganis, B. Falsafi, G.N. Gaydadjiev, S. Isaza, A. Malek, R. Mariani, D.K. Pradhan, G. Rauwerda, R.M. Seepers, R.A. Shafik, G. Smaragdos, D. Theodoropoulos, S. Tzilis, M. Vavouras, S. Pagliarini, and D. Pnevmatikatos, "DeSyRe: On-Demand Adaptive and Reconfigurable Fault-Tolerant SoCs", 10th Int'l Symp. on Applied Reconfigurable Computing (ARC), Vilamoura, Algarve, Portugal, LNCS 8405, pp. 312--317, 2014.

29. Robert M. Seepers, Christos Strydis, Ioannis Sourdis and Chris de Zeeuw, "Adaptive entity-identifier generation for IMD emergency access", First Workshop on Cryptography and Security in Computing Systems (CS2 2014, ACM), held in conjunction with the Int'l Conf. on High Performance Architectures and Compilers (HiPEAC), pp 41-44, Vienna, Austria 2014.

30. Pavlos Katsogridakis, Polyvios Pratikakis, "Micro-checkpointing in fault tolerant runtimes", Proceedings of the 11th ACM Conference on Computing Frontiers (CF 2014), Cagliari, Italy 2014

31. M. van Eijk, C. Galuzzi, A. Zjajo, G. Smaragdos, C. Strydis and R. van Leuken, ESL Design of Customizable Real-Time Neuron Networks, BioCAS 2014, October 22-24, EPFL, Switzerland.

32. M.N. van Dongen, A. Karapatis, L. Kros, O.H.J. Eelkman Rooda, R.M. Seepers, C. Strydis, C.I. de Zeeuw, F.E. Hoebeek and W.A. Serdijn, An Implementation of a Wavelet-Based Seizure Detection Filter Suitable for Realtime Closed-Loop Epileptic Seizure Suppression, BioCAS 2014, October 22-24, EPFL, Switzerland.

33. M. Ottavi, S. Pontarelli, D. Gizopoulos, C. Bolchini, M. K. Michael, L. Anghel, M. Tahoori, A. Paschalis, P. Reviriego, O. Bringmann, V. Izosimov, H. Manhaeve, C. Strydis, S. Hamdioui, Dependable Multicore Architectures at Nanoscale and their Applications: the view from Europe, IEEE Design & Test [To appear]

34. D. Rodopoulos, G. Chatzikonstantis, A. Padelopoulos, C.I. De Zeeuw, C. Strydis, Optimal Mapping of Inferior Olive Neuron Simulations on the Single-Chip Cloud Computer, SAMOS XIV, July 14-17, 2014, Samos, Greece, pp. 367-374.

35.D. Riemens, G. N. Gaydadjiev, C. I. De Zeeuw, C. Strydis, Towards scalable arithmetic units with graceful degradation, ACM Trans. Embed. Comput. Syst. (TECS) 13, 4, Article 87 (March 2014), 87:1-26

36. The "Parliament” magazine. The official European Union’s magazine. Issue 394/395 21 July 2014.

37. Samuel PAGLIARINI and Dhiraj PRADHAN "A Placement Strategy for Reducing the Effects of Multiple Faults in Digital Circuits",20th IEEE International On-Line Testing Symposium, IEEE IOLTS 2014

38. Samuel PAGLIARINI, Lirida. NAVINER, JeanFrancois NAVINER, Dhiraj PRADHAN," A Hybrid Reliability Assessment Method and its Support of Sequential Logic Modelling" 20th IEEE International On-Line Testing Symposium, IEEE IOLTS 2014

39. M. Bandan, S. Bhattacharjee, Dhiraj K. Pradhan, Jimson Mathew: Energy Efficient Lifetime Reliability-Aware Checkpointing for Real-Time System. J. Low Power Electronics 10(3): 401-416 (2014)

40. L. Sun, Jimson Mathew, Samuel N. Pagliarini, Dhiraj K. Pradhan, Ioannis Sourdis: Design and Analysis of Binary Tree Static Random Access Memory for Low Power Embedded Systems. J. Low Power Electronics 10(3): 467-478 (2014)

41. S. Pagliarini S. Pontarelli J. Mathew D.K. Pradhan, I. Sourdis D. A. Khan A. Malek S. Tzilis, G. Smaragdos C. Strydis, “Efficient online testing of an array of reconfigurable RISC Processors”, Manufacturable and Dependable Multicore Architectures at Nanoscale (MEDIAN’15), Grenoble, France, 13 March 2015.